International Journal of Radiation Biology | 2001
Zhang Suping; Pan Jing-Xi; Han Zhen‐Hui; Zhao Jingquan; Yao Side; Jiang Lijin
Purpose : To explore the photophysical and photochemical properties of allophycocyanin (APC) and contribute to the understanding of the molecular mechanism of APC photosensitization. Materials and methods : Laser-flash photolytic and pulse radiolytic techniques were used for the first time to characterize the transient intermediates involved in APC photochemistry and photophysics. The excited triplet state and radical cation of APC were identified by acetone sensitization and one-electron oxidation. Results : The 248-nm laser-flash photolysis of APC in N 2 -saturated aqueous solution (pH 7.0) yields the triplet state and radical cation of APC. The APC radical cations were generated by ionization via a monophotonic process, with a quantum yield of 0.17. Conclusions : APC can undergo both photo-excitation and photo-ionization under the present experimental conditions. These new findings suggest that APC has the potential to act as both a type I and type II photosensitizer.
Progress in Natural Science | 2007
Wen Chenglu; Li Heng; Wang Pengbo; Li Wei; Zhao Jingquan
Abstract Phototactic movement is a characteristic of some microorganisms, response to light environment. Most of the algae have dramatically phototactic responses, underlying the complicated biological, physical and photochemical mechanisms are involved. With the development of the micro/nano and sensor techniques, great progress has been made in the research of the algae phototaxis. This review article summarizes the progress made in the research on the functional phototactic structures, the mechanisms of photo-response process and photodynamics of phototaxis in algae, and describes the latest developed micro-tracking technique and micromanipulation technique. Moreover, based on our o research results, the potential correlation between the phototaxis and photosynthesis is discussed, and the directions for future research of the phototactic mechanism are proposed. *Supported by National Natural Science Foundation of China (Grant No. 30570422)
